Can Potting Mix In A Raised Garden Bed Be Rehydrated?

.Hello. Maybe this isn’t possible, since the soil can’t be immersed. The bed gets the full summer afternoon sun

You should be able to rehydrate with a slow soak with a garden hose or other type of irrigation. However, you may want to sterilize the soil before replanting in the area. Here's an article that will tell you how:
